Grade A, and why
claude-design sc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 5d ago.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

Claude Design for CLI/API Agents
Use this skill when the user asks for design work that would normally fit Claude Design, but the agent is running in a CLI/API environment instead of the hosted Claude Design web UI.
The goal is to preserve Claude Design's useful design behavior and taste while removing hosted-tool plumbing that does not exist in normal agent environments.
Before starting, check for other web-design skills like popular-web-designs (ready-to-paste design systems for Stripe, Linear, Vercel, Notion, etc.) and design-md (Google's DESIGN.md token spec format). If the user wants a known brand's look, load popular-web-designs alongside this one and let it supply the visual vocabulary. If the deliverable is a token spec file rather than a rendered artifact, use design-md instead. Full decision table below.
When To Use This Skill vs popular-web-designs vs design-md
Cogitum has three design-related skills under skills/creative/. They do different jobs — load the right one (or combine them):
| Skill | What it gives you | Use when the user wants... |
|---|---|---|
| claude-design (this one) | Design process and taste — how to scope a brief, gather context, produce variants, verify a local HTML artifact, avoid AI-design slop | a from-scratch designed artifact (landing page, prototype, deck, component lab, motion study) with no specific brand or token system dictated |
| popular-web-designs | 54 ready-to-paste design systems — exact colors, typography, components, CSS values for sites like Stripe, Linear, Vercel, Notion, Airbnb | "make it look like Stripe / Linear / Vercel", a page styled after a known brand, or a visual starting point pulled from a real product |
| design-md | Google's DESIGN.md spec format — author/validate/diff/export design-token files, WCAG contrast checking, Tailwind/DTCG export | a formal, persistent, machine-readable design-system spec file (tokens + rationale) that lives in a repo and gets consumed by agents over time |
